Record 1, Main entry term, English
- levelized energy cost
1, record 1, English, levelized%20energy%20cost
correct, standardized
Record 1, Abbreviations, English
Record 1, Synonyms, English
Record 1, Textual support, English
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 DEF
The cost of energy production in a uniform calculational level, for example, based on the assumption of the equal depreciation method, rate of interest, life-time of the plant adjusted on a "present worth" method, load factor and annual utilization period. 1, record 1, English, - levelized%20energy%20cost

Record number: 5, Textual support number: 1 CONT
It is also assumed in this model that the annual failure rate for one plant is constant over time. This may not hold if either (1) failure rates increase because of wear and tear, or (2) failure rates decrease because of interim inspections and more stringent regulations. Probabilities of disaster would increase in the first case and decrease in the second case. 2, record 5, English, - failure%20rate

Record 13, Main entry term, English
- Kant-Laplace hypothesis 1, record 13, English, Kant%2DLaplace%20hypothesis
Record 13, Abbreviations, English
Record 13, Synonyms, English
Record 13, Textual support, English
Record number: 13, Textual support number: 1 OBS
Once the [gaseous] disk had formed, Laplace suggested, it would in turn contract. In so doing it would periodically leave smaller rings or "zones of vapors" which would become detached from the main disk by ceasing to contract. Each of these detached rings would then coalesce into a planet by forming a little eddy of its own; and the rotation of this eddy would in turn form smaller gaseous rings from which the new planet's satellites would form. 2, record 13, English, - Kant%2DLaplace%20hypothesis
